Pell Frischmann in Exeter is seeking a skilled consultant in Land Contamination Risk Management to undertake assessments, prepare technical reports, and support project delivery.
The ideal candidate will have a degree in environmental science, relevant memberships, and experience in UK consultancy. You will manage client relationships, work collaboratively with the team, and ensure compliance with standards and regulations.
The position includes opportunities for personal development and a supportive work environment.
